人工智能技术高效化背后的深度学习优化机制
2025-07-01

人工智能技术近年来在多个领域取得了显著突破,尤其在图像识别、自然语言处理、语音合成等方面表现卓越。这些成果的背后,深度学习作为核心技术支撑,发挥了不可替代的作用。而深度学习之所以能实现高效化,离不开其背后的优化机制。理解这些机制,不仅有助于我们更好地掌握当前AI发展的脉络,也为未来的技术演进提供方向。

深度学习模型本质上是一组具有大量参数的神经网络结构,其训练过程涉及复杂的数学计算和大规模数据处理。为了提升模型的训练效率和推理性能,研究人员开发了多种优化机制,涵盖算法层面、架构设计以及硬件协同等多个维度。

首先,在算法优化方面,梯度下降及其变体是深度学习中最基础也是最关键的优化方法。传统的随机梯度下降(SGD)通过不断调整参数以最小化损失函数,但其收敛速度较慢且容易陷入局部最优。为了解决这些问题,研究者提出了如动量法(Momentum)、RMSProp 和 Adam 等自适应优化算法。这些方法通过对梯度的历史信息进行加权或归一化处理,使模型在训练过程中更稳定、更快地收敛。此外,近年来兴起的学习率调度策略,如余弦退火、循环学习率等,也有效提升了训练效率与泛化能力。

其次,在模型结构优化上,现代深度学习框架引入了诸如残差连接、注意力机制、轻量化模块等多种创新结构。例如,ResNet 通过残差块解决了深层网络中的梯度消失问题,使得模型可以构建得更深而不影响训练效果;Transformer 模型则利用自注意力机制实现了全局依赖建模,极大地提升了自然语言处理任务的性能。与此同时,MobileNet、SqueezeNet 等轻量化网络的设计,使得深度学习模型可以在资源受限的设备上运行,推动了边缘计算的发展。

第三,数据处理与增强技术也是提高深度学习效率的重要手段。高质量的数据集是模型训练的基础,而数据增强技术则通过旋转、裁剪、噪声注入等方式扩充训练样本,从而提升模型的鲁棒性和泛化能力。此外,数据预处理中的标准化、归一化操作也有助于加快模型收敛速度。对于大规模数据集,分布式数据加载与异步读取技术能够显著减少I/O瓶颈,提高整体训练吞吐量。

硬件加速与系统优化方面,GPU、TPU 等专用计算芯片的应用大幅提升了深度学习的计算效率。现代深度学习框架如 TensorFlow 和 PyTorch 都支持自动微分和计算图优化,能够将模型运算自动分配到不同的硬件设备中执行。此外,混合精度训练、模型量化、剪枝与蒸馏等技术也在降低模型复杂度的同时保持了较高的准确率。例如,知识蒸馏通过让小模型模仿大模型的输出分布来提升其性能,是一种高效的模型压缩方式。

最后,自动化机器学习(AutoML)与超参数调优工具的出现,也为深度学习的高效化提供了新路径。传统模型训练往往需要人工调整学习率、批量大小、正则化系数等超参数,费时且效果难以保证。而 AutoML 利用贝叶斯优化、网格搜索、进化算法等策略,自动寻找最优模型配置,显著降低了调参门槛,提高了模型部署的效率。

综上所述,深度学习的高效化并非单一技术的突破,而是多方面优化机制协同作用的结果。从算法改进到模型结构创新,从数据增强到硬件加速,再到自动化调参,每一步都为人工智能技术的实际落地提供了坚实支撑。随着研究的深入和技术的进步,未来的深度学习优化机制将更加智能化、系统化,为人工智能的广泛应用打开新的可能空间。

15201532315 CONTACT US

公司:赋能智赢信息资讯传媒(深圳)有限公司

地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15

Q Q:3874092623

Copyright © 2022-2025

粤ICP备2025361078号

咨询 在线客服在线客服 电话:13545454545
微信 微信扫码添加我